본문 바로가기
Creo/Creo 환경 설정

설계 생산성 향상을 위한 Model Tree 기능

by 아이디티 2021. 4. 2.

모델 Tree를 활용해야 하는 이유

 

모델 트리는 데이텀 및 좌표계를 포함하여 부품 파일의 모든 피쳐 목록을 표시합니다. 어셈블리 파일에서 모델 트리는

어셈블리 파일 이름과 그 아래에 포함 된 부품 파일이 표시됩니다. 모델 구조는 트리 맨 위에 루트 객체 (현재 부품 또는

어셈블리)가 있고, 아래에 하위 객체 (부품 또는 피쳐)가있는 계층(트리) 형식으로 표시됩니다.

 

Creo Parametric 창이 여러 개 열려있는 경우 모델 트리 내용은 현재 창에있는 파일을 반영합니다.

 

모델 트리에는 현재 파일의 관련 피쳐 및 부품 수준 개체 만 나열되며 피쳐를 구성하는 모서리, 서피스, 커브 등과 같은 엔티티는 나열되지 않습니다. 각 모델 트리 항목에는 숨김, 어셈블리, 부품, 피쳐 또는 데이텀 평면 (피쳐)과 같은 개체 

유형을 반영하는 아이콘이 포함되어 있습니다. 

 

아이콘은 기능, 부품 또는 어셈블리에 대한 표시 또는 재생성 상태 (예 : 억제됨 또는 재생성되지 않음)도 표시 할 수 

있습니다.

 

 

 

어셈블리 모드에서 설명 , 모델링 한 사람 , 데이터베이스 상태 및 피처 이름과 같은 추가 열을 표시 할 수 있습니다.

Query 기능을 활용하여 빠르게 모델을 검색 할수 있습니다. 

 

CREO 6.0 버전은 Model Tree 기능이 업그레이드 되었습니다

 

* 쿼리(Query)란 데이터베이스에 정보를 요청하는 것이다. 쿼리는 웹 서버에 특정한 정보를 보여달라는 웹 클라이언트 요청(주로 문자열을 기반으로 한 요청이다)에 의한 처리이다.  쿼리는 대개 데이터베이스로부터 특정한 주제어나 어귀를 찾기 위해 사용된다. 주제어가 검색엔진의 검색필드 내에 입력된 다음, 그 내용이 웹 서버로 넘겨진다.

 

"모델 Tree는 설계에 필요한 다양한 정보를 표시할수 있고, 내부의 부품, Feature 검색이 가능

설계의 생산성을 향상 시킬 수 있습니다." 


모델 Tree 구성 파일 저장 및 불러오기

 

모델 Tree는 필요에 따라 화면 구성을 저장 할수 있습니다. Creo 6.0 부터는 자동으로 모델 tree가 저장되고, 후속 Croe

모델 생성에 계속하여 사용됩니다. 

 

config.pro 파일의 mdl_tree_cfg_file을 사용하여 creo 시작 할때 표준 모델 tree환경을 설정 할수 있습니다

하지만 Creo Start Template 적용하여 사용할 수 있습니다.

 

Import / Export

 

모델 Tree에서 매개변수 검색 방법

 

어셈블을 사용하다 보면, 품번 품명으로 부품을 검색 할 필요가 있습니다. 모델 tree의 검색 기능으로 보다 쉽게 모델을 

검색 할수 있습니다 .모델 tree 환경 설정에서 검색 기능을 클릭합니다.

 

매개변수 검색

 

모델 Tree에서 구성 부품을  다양하게 표시 할수 있습니다.

   

Mdel Tree 환경 설정

 

 

 

 

모델 Tree  쿼리(Query) 기능

Hide 명령과 검색 범위를 정의 하는 Type 명령과 혼합 한다면, 보다 쉽게 어셈블 파일에서 구성원들을 쉽게 검색

할수 있습니다

  

쿼리( Query) 명령

 

모델 Tree 쿼리(Query)

Creo 파일에 Paramter 및 값이 정확하게 입력 되어 있으면, 제작된 모델을 좀더 스마트하게 활용 할수 있습니다. 예를 들어 판금 제품을 모두 찾고, 무게가 무거운 제품이 무엇인지 검색 할수 있습니다. PTC에서 제공한는 VBA 엑셀 개발 Tool을 활용 한다면, 필요한 매개변수 및 값을 수동 또는 자동으로 모델에 입력 하고,  필요에 따라 모델의 파일 이름과 Parameter를 엑셀 파일로 Export 하고, "차트"를 자동으로 만들수 있을것 입니다. Windchill 프로그램을 사용하시는 분은 Rest API를 이용하여 Windchill에 저장된 모델의 특성값을 기간 시스템과 연계할 수 있을것 입니다. 

 

구글과 유튜브에는 VBA에 대한 기초 교육과 활용 예제가 많습니다. 한글로된 자료도 많고, 다른 언어의 경우 구글, 유튜브 번역을 이용하면 됩니다.  

 

 

 

머신런링에 관심을 가져 보십시오.  설계에 어떡해 응용 할까요?